These poems are from the book "The Rose that grew from concrete". This Book contains 71 poems by Tupac which he had written at an age of 18, before he began translating his poems into rhymes. For more infos on the book click here all poems are property of Amaru Records

Architects of Poverty

Of an estimated 1 billion people in the world who are trapped in a  cycle of grinding poverty and despair,a disproportionate number live in Sub-Saharan Africa.
in this book Moeletsi Mbeki analyses the plight of Africa and concludes that the fault lies not with the mass of its people but with its rulers.
The Political elites who contrive to keep their fellow citizens poor while enriching themselves.Architects of Poverty Its criticism from within, which also says entrepreneurship is the answer out of this dependency syndrome hope you will enjoy.
